High horsepower engines need to be fed the proper amount of both fuel and air to keep the engine happy. The need for more air flow can mean the stock MAF sensor can get maxed out. In situations where the engine is making 320 Wheel HP or more, the factory MAF sensor will become maxed out! This limits the amount of Horsepower your ECU can be tuned for. PERRIN™ has devised a way to literally sneak additional airflow around the MAF to increase resolution in timing and fuel maps on your tuned ECU. The BigMAF is meant for cars running more than 320 WHP or cars that make enough power to outflow the stock intake system. This happens mainly on 2.5L Turbo motors when a bigger turbo is installed.
The BigMAF is designed to do two things:
1. Allow the ECU to read more airflow than the stock intake system. This allows the ECU to be tuned for Wheel HP ratings up to 500WHP on up. This allows for more resolution in the fuel and timing mapping so the engine can be safely tuned.
2. The BigMAF offsets 800cc fuel injectors. The size of the BigMAF housing was designed around this larger size to make for easier tuning injectors. This means that when tuning the ECU, the fuel injector size will stay about the same as stock which makes for easier tuning. This also makes some of the other internal parameters in the ECU work better so the car runs smoother.
One thing people do wrong when starting with tuning the BigMAF is going and changing the injector size to 800cc then increaseing the MAF scaling to make up for the large size. The correct way is to leave the scaling and injector size alone, then adjust the injector size slightly to get the idle and light throttle fuel corrections close. From there tuning of the MAF curve can be done, but will be very minor changes. That should be enought to get you close on your tune.
